WebAug 21, 2024 · Electronegativity therefore decreases down the group ( At < I < Br < Cl < F). Electron Affinity (d ecreases down the group) Since the atomic size increases down the group, electron affinity generally decreases ( At < I < Br < F < Cl). An electron will not be as attracted to the nucleus, resulting in a low electron affinity. WebAug 10, 2024 · Discover the periodic properties (trends) at the recurring table of elements.
